About P. Brewer
P. Brewer is a scholar working on Orthodontics, Oral Surgery, Biomedical Engineering, Surgery and Molecular Biology, having authored 17 papers that have together received 614 indexed citations. Recurring topics across this work include Dental materials and restorations (8 papers), Dental Implant Techniques and Outcomes (5 papers), Bone Tissue Engineering Materials (5 papers), Dental Erosion and Treatment (3 papers), Hydrogen's biological and therapeutic effects (1 paper), Orthodontics and Dentofacial Orthopedics (1 paper), Bone and Dental Protein Studies (1 paper) and Endodontics and Root Canal Treatments (1 paper). The work is most often cited by research in Orthodontics (295 citations), General Dentistry (58 citations), Oral Surgery (227 citations), Periodontics (24 citations) and Urology (28 citations). P. Brewer has collaborated with scholars based in United States, Japan and Hungary. Frequent co-authors include Masahiro Yoshiyama, Jack A. Horner, Hidehiko Sano, R.M. Carvalho, D.H. Pashley, Francis T. Lake, Allen L. Sisk, Gregory R. Parr, David E. Steflik and P. J. Hanes. Their work appears in journals such as Journal of Biomedical Materials Research, Journal of Periodontology, Archives of Oral Biology, Dental Materials and Cells Tissues Organs.
